Key Details of IIT Bhilai Recruitment 2026
| Company Name | Indian Institute of Technology, Bhilai |
|---|---|
| Post Name | Project Engineer / Project Assistant |
| No of Posts | 2 |
| Salary | Rs. 28000 – 75000 Per Month |
| Qualification | M.Tech/M.E./B.Tech in Electrical Engineering |
| Age Limit | Project Engineer: 40-45 years; Project Assistant: 35 years |
| Last Date | 15 March 2026 |
| Apply Mode | Online |
| Job Type | Contract |

Selection Process
The selection process for the IIT Bhilai recruitment involves an offline interview. Candidates will be informed about the interview schedule after the applications have been received. It is important to note that no travel allowance (TA) or daily allowance (DA) will be provided for attending the interview.
The decision of the selection committee will be final, and they may restrict the number of candidates for interviews based on qualifications and experience. This ensures that the most suitable candidates are selected for these important roles.
